Solve s=2(lw+lh+wh) for w
Scilla [17]

                                                                   s = 2(lw + lh + wh)

Divide each side by  2 :                            s/2 = lw + lh + wh

Subtract 'lh' from each side:                s/2 - lh = lw + wh

Combine the 'w' terms:                        s/2 - lh = w(l + h)

Divide each side by (l + h):  (s/2 - lh) / (l + h) = w

Find the volume of a right circular cone that has a height of 14.3 ft and a base with a diameter of 17.2 ft. Round your answer t
saveliy_v [14]

Answer:

Volume of the given cone is 1107.6 cubic feet.

Step-by-step explanation:

Formula to get the volume of a right circular cone is,

V = \frac{1}{3}\pi r^{2}h

Here r = radius of the circular base

h = height of the cone

Now we put the values in the given formula

Volume = \frac{1}{3}\pi (8.6)^2(14.3)  [ radius = \frac{17.2}{2}=8.6 ]

             = \frac{1057.628\pi }{3}

             = 1107.55

             ≈ 1107.6 cubic feet

Therefore, volume of the given cone is 1107.6 cubic feet.
